Switch a surface's provider

How a surface comes to point at a connected tool instead of Crusible's own store, or back again, without touching the channel or its conversation.

A surface is backed either by Crusible’s own store or by a connected tool, and either direction is the same action. A team that keeps its issues in Linear points Issues at Linear, and a team that would rather keep them beside the conversation points Issues back at Crusible. Neither is a step up from the other.

The control is a tool’s row in Integrations, which is workspace-level, so what switches is every surface that tool backs. Most tools back one: Linear backs Issues, Notion backs Docs, Sentry backs Dashboards. GitHub and GitLab each back two — Forge and Review — and switching either moves both.

  1. Select Settings, then, under Account, open Integrations.

    Result The pane lists every tool the workspace can connect, with the connected ones reading “Connected” under the account they were authorised as. This one pane holds both directions of the switch, for every surface the tool backs.

  2. Find the surface you are switching, by the tool that backs it now and the tool you want backing it next, and check whether either tool backs a second surface you did not mean to move.

    Result Each row's one-line description names what it backs. A surface is backed by one provider at a time, so the row you are switching to is the row that holds the record afterwards.

  3. Select Connect on the tool you are switching to, and authorise it — or select Disconnect on the tool you are leaving.

    Result Switching to a connected tool: the row reads “Connected”, names the account, and the surface reads from the tool from then on. Switching back to Crusible: the row loses its “Connected” state, and the surface reads from Crusible's own store from then on.

  4. Open a channel that has the surface enabled and select it in the surface switcher.

    Result Every surface that tool backs changes, and nothing else does. The channel keeps its name, its members, its agents, its other surfaces and its whole conversation. Work already recorded in the tool you left stays in that tool, where it was recorded, under the account that recorded it — so a surface pointed back at Crusible reads Crusible's own store, which holds none of that work.

  5. If this doesn't work

    If Account does not appear in Settings, or Integrations is missing from it, your sign-in does not hold the permission that opens it: a pane you may not open is absent rather than shown and disabled, so ask whoever created the workspace to grant it. If the surface still shows the old data, the surface is reading a provider that is still connected — read the Integrations rows again and confirm the one you meant to leave no longer reads Connected. If a second surface changed too, that tool backs both of them, which is what the row does rather than a fault. If the surface shows nothing after a switch, the account you authorised may not be able to see the project or repository you expected on the tool’s side. If the channel itself looks different, something other than this switch changed it: the channel’s name, members, agents and conversation are set in the channel’s own settings. Each surface the tool backs then answers to the provider you chose, and the Integrations pane says which. What does not change is everything else: the channel, its members, its agents, its other surfaces, and the conversation that holds the work. The same steps run in the other direction the day the team wants them to.
